    Responsibilities

    • Preparing fire strategies for a wide range of buildings using ADB, BS9999, BS9991, BS7974, HTM Guidance and BB100 among other documents.
    • Take a lead on Technical projects
    • Manage medium/large size projects including fee proposals and invoicing.
    • Be the expert to our clients and that all important first point of call.
    • Lead discussion with design team, building control and fire service.
    • Attend industry conferences to network and embrace industry trends and best practices
